The work:

  • Design, build, and configure applications to meet business process and application requirements.

  • Act as a subject matter expert, collaborating and managing the team to ensure effective performance.

  • Take ownership of team decisions, engage with multiple teams, and contribute to key decisions.

  • Provide solutions to problems for your immediate team and across multiple teams.

  • Develop innovative application solutions that enhance user experience and meet business needs.

  • Conduct thorough testing and debugging to ensure application reliability and performance.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ements and translate them into technical specifications.

  • Stay updated with the latest industry trends and technologies to continuously improve application development processes.

  • Mentor junior team members and share knowledge to foster a collaborative learning environment.

This role is in our local ATC (Montreal) and will require on-site work 2-3 days per week
